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Repair
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Don’t wait until it’s too late – here are some common warning signs you need water damage repair: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show hidden moisture in your walls, ceilings, or floors. Don’t ignore these signs – they can lead to mold growth and structural damage.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a larger issue, including hidden leaks or burst pipes. Don’t delay – address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age or excessive moisture. Don’t wait until it’s too late – address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or excessive moisture. Don’t ignore these signs – they can lead to structural damage and health hazards.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can show a larger issue, including burst pipes or hidden leaks. Don’t delay – address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.

Water Damage Repair Cost in DeSoto, TX
The cost of water damage repair can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in DeSoto, TX.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of water damage, and local labor costs |
| Dehumidification and drying |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of water damage, and local labor costs |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of water damage, and local labor costs |
| Reconstruction and repair | $5,000 – $20,000 | Size of affected area, type of water damage, and local labor costs |

Common Questions About Water Damage Repair
How long does water damage repair take?
The length of time it takes to repair water damage depends on the severity and size of the affected area. Typically, it can take anywhere from a few days to several weeks to complete the repair process.

Can I prevent water damage from happening in the first place?
Yes, you can take steps to prevent water damage from happening in the first place. Regular maintenance, such as checking for leaks and inspecting your home’s roof, can help prevent water damage.
